首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

单击无响应id的事件处理程序。(至少--我认为是这样)

单击无响应id的事件处理程序是指在前端开发中,当用户单击某个元素(如按钮、链接等)时,对应的事件处理程序无法正常响应或执行的情况。这可能是由于错误的id值、未正确绑定事件处理程序、事件处理程序中存在错误等原因导致的。

为了解决单击无响应id的事件处理程序的问题,可以采取以下步骤:

  1. 检查id值:确保所需元素的id值正确无误。可以通过查看HTML代码或使用开发者工具来确认id值是否与事件处理程序中的id匹配。
  2. 检查事件绑定:确认事件处理程序已正确绑定到对应元素上。可以使用JavaScript或相关框架(如jQuery)来绑定事件,确保事件处理程序与元素的id或其他选择器匹配。
  3. 检查事件处理程序:检查事件处理程序中是否存在语法错误、逻辑错误或其他错误。可以使用浏览器的开发者工具来查看控制台输出,以便找到可能的错误信息。
  4. 确保元素存在:确保要绑定事件处理程序的元素存在于DOM中。如果元素是通过动态生成或异步加载的,需要确保在事件绑定之前元素已经存在于DOM中。
  5. 调试和测试:使用调试工具和技术(如断点调试、日志输出等)来定位和解决问题。可以逐步检查代码,确认事件处理程序是否被正确调用和执行。

对于单击无响应id的事件处理程序问题,腾讯云提供了一系列相关产品和服务,如:

  • 云函数(Serverless):通过云函数,可以将事件处理程序部署在云端,实现无服务器的事件处理。详情请参考:腾讯云云函数
  • 云开发(CloudBase):云开发提供了一站式的后端服务,包括数据库、存储、云函数等,可以帮助开发者快速搭建和部署应用。详情请参考:腾讯云云开发
  • 腾讯云CDN:通过使用CDN加速,可以提高前端资源的加载速度,减少单击无响应的可能性。详情请参考:腾讯云CDN

请注意,以上仅为腾讯云提供的一些相关产品和服务,其他云计算品牌商也提供类似的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

js事件防止冒泡

大家好,又见面了,是全栈君。 1. 事件目标 如今。事件处理程序变量event保存着事件对象。而event.target属性保存着发生事件目标元素。...  //……    event.stopPropagation();   })  })  同曾经一样,须要为用作单击处理程序函数加入一个參数。...以便訪问事件对象。然后。通过简单地调用event.stopPropagation()就能够避免其它全部DOM元素响应这个事件这样一来,单击button事件会被button处理。...默认操作 假设我们把单击事件处理程序注冊到一个锚元素,而不是一个外层上,那么就要面对另外一个问题:当用户单击链接时。浏览器会载入一个新页面。...这样行为与我们讨论事件处理程序不是同一个概念,它是单击锚元素默认操作。类似地,当用户在编辑完表单后按下回车键时。会触发表单submit事件,在此事件发生后,表单提交才会真正发生。

2.5K40

windows 应急流程及实战演练

常见应急响应事件分类: web 入侵:网页挂马、主页篡改、Webshell 系统入侵:病毒木马、勒索软件、远控后门 网络攻击:DDOS 攻击、DNS 劫持、ARP 欺骗 针对常见攻击事件,结合工作中应急响应事件分析和解决方法...检查方法: a、登录服务器,单击【开始】>【所有程序】>【启动】,默认情况下此目录在是一个空目录,确认是否有非业务程序在该目录下。...打开安全日志,在右边点击筛选当前日志, 在事件 ID 填入 4625,查询到事件 ID4625,事件数 177007,从这个数据可以看出,服务器正则遭受暴力破解: ?...0x04 应急响应实战之蠕虫病毒 蠕虫病毒是一种十分古老计算机病毒,它是一种自包含程序(或是一套程序),通常通过网络途径传播,每入侵到一台新计算机,它就在这台计算机上复制自己,并自动执行它自身程序...具体技术分析细节详见 《利用WebLogic漏洞挖矿事件分析》: https://www.anquanke.com/post/id/92223 清除挖矿病毒:关闭异常进程、删除c盘temp目录下挖矿程序

2.8K50

【译】用纯JavaScript写一个简单MVC App

我们只是还没办法连接它们 - 没有事件监听用户输入,也没有处理程序处理此类事件输出。 控制台仍然作为临时控制器存在,你可以通过它添加和删除待办事项。 ?...当你提交新待办事项,单击删除按钮或单击待办事项复选框时,将触发一个事件。视图必须监听那些事件,因为它是视图中用户输入,但是它将把响应事件将要发生事情责任派发到控制器。...我们必须将事件监听器放在视图DOM元素上。我们将响应表单上submit事件,然后单击click并更改change待办事项列表上事件。(由于略为复杂,这里略过"编辑")。...响应模型中回调 我们遗漏了一些东西 - 事件正在监听,处理程序被调用,但是什么也没有发生。这是因为模型不知道视图应该更新,也不知道如何进行视图更新。...使用纯JavaScript依赖待办事项应用程序,演示了模型-视图-控制器结构概念。下面再次放出完整案例和源码地址。

1.9K10

驱动库分享整理(1)——用于单片机中小巧多功能按键支持库

1==、 MultiButton:是一个小巧简单易用事件驱动型按键驱动模块,可无限量扩展按键,按键事件回调异步处理方式可以简化你程序结构,去除冗余按键处理硬编码,让你按键业务逻辑更清晰 https...:是一个基于标准C语言小巧灵活按键处理库,支持单击、连击、短按、长按、自动消抖,可以自由设置组合按键,可用于中断和低功耗场景。...,也无须逐一编写各事件条件判断,                                           只须为需要按键事件编写相应响应代码即可,同时留有特殊键组合等扩展接口;                      ...而这种所谓不支持连续按(按键一次只执行一次操作)实际上又可以有两种实现方式: 一种是只要按下就执行操作(反正一般按键你总是要松开先执行了再说,这种表现出来就是响应速度快,用户体验好) 另外一种处理方式就是严格等按键释放后才被认为是一次按键...事实上等待按键释放后才被认为是一次按键还可以派生出一种按键,那就是长按,只有按下不松开超出指定时间(如2秒以上)就被认为是一次长按事件成立。

99210

Android 手势识别应用:手把手教你学会 GestureDetector(含实例讲解)

函数,将View触屏事件交给GestureDetector处理,从而对用户手势作出响应 View.setOnTouchListener(new View.OnTouchListener() {...函数,将触屏事件交给GestureDetector处理,从而对用户手势作出响应 mTextView = (TextView) findViewById(R.id.textView);...函数,将View触屏事件交给GestureDetector处理,从而对用户手势作出响应 View.setOnTouchListener(new View.OnTouchListener() {...函数,将触屏事件交给GestureDetector处理,从而对用户手势作出响应 mTextView = (TextView) findViewById(R.id.textView);...函数,将触屏事件交给GestureDetector处理,从而对用户手势作出响应 mTextView = (TextView) findViewById(R.id.textView);

8.6K41

今天聊聊DOM事件传播机制

我们程序可以检测这些事件,然后对此作出响应。从而形成一种交互。 这样可以使我们页面变得更加有意思,而不仅仅像以前一样只能进行浏览。...这个事件监听器类似于一个通知,当事件发生时,事件监听器会让我们知道,然后程序就可以做出相应响应。...也就是说,我们可以为整个页面指定一个 onclick 事件处理程序,而不必给每个可单击元素分别添加事件处理程序。...举一个具体例子,例如现在列表项有如下内容: red yellow blue ...也就是说,我们可以为整个页面指定一个 onclick 事件处理程序,而不必给每个可单击元素分别添加事件处理程序

96420

Android之有效防止按钮多次重复点击

为了防止测试妹子或者用户频繁点击某个按钮,导致程序在短时间内进行多次数据提交or数据处理,那到时候就比较坑了~ 那么如何有效避免这种情况发生呢?...想法是,判断用户点击按钮间隔时间,如果间隔时间太短,则认为是无效操作,否则进行相关业务处理 首先将这块提取为工具类(方便接下来调用),现在就起名为:ButtonUtils public class...return isFastDoubleClick(-1, DIFF); } /** * 判断两次点击间隔,如果小于1000,则认为是多次无效点击 * * @return...ButtonUtils.isFastDoubleClick(R.id.gv_integralstore):这块是关键。...想法就是在单击事件中进行判断,看看当前点击事件是否为有效点击事件 好了,一个简单又实用防止按钮多次重复点击工具类就搞定了。。。 如果大家还有什么比较实用方法,,,可以一起交流哈~

1.6K10

用纯 JavaScript 撸一个 MVC 框架

作者:Tania 翻译:疯狂技术宅 来源:taniarascia ? 想用 model-view-controller 架构模式在纯 JavaScript 中写一个简单程序,于是这样做了。...它需要用户输入,例如单击或键入,并处理用户交互回调。 模型永远不会触及视图。视图永远不会触及模型。控制器用来连接它们。 想提一下,为一个简单 todo 程序做 MVC 实际上是一大堆样板。...当你提交新待办事项、单击删除按钮或单击待办事项复选框时,将触发一个事件。视图必须侦听这些事件,因为它们是视图用户输入,它会将响应事件所要做工作分配给控制器。 我们将为事件创建 handler。...它将响应删除按钮上 click 事件。删除按钮父元素是 todo li 本身,它附有相应 id。我们需要将该数据发送给正确模型方法。...按照处理单击删除按钮方式处理此方法,并调用模型方法。

3.2K41

前端Ajax技术原理

XMLHttpRequest是ajax核心机制,它是在IE5中首先引入,是一种支持异步请求技术。简单说,也就是javascript可以及时向服务器提出请求和处理响应,而不阻塞用户。...它属性有: onreadystatechange 每次状态改变所触发事件事件处理程序。 responseText 从服务器进程返回数据字符串形式。...并且减轻服务器负担,ajax原则是“按需取数据”,可以最大程度减少冗余请求,和响应对服务器造成负担。 4、基于标准化并被广泛支持技术,不需要下载插件或者小程序。...(例如,当用户在Google Maps中单击后退时,它在一个隐藏IFRAME中进行搜索,然后将搜索结果反映到Ajax元素上,以便将应用程序状态恢复到当时状态。)...至少从目前看来,像ajax.dll,ajaxpro.dll这些ajax框架是会破坏程序异常机制。关于这个问题,曾经在开发过程中遇到过,但是查了一下网上几乎没有相关介绍。

61800

activiti工作流开发_flowable工作流

进入Kickstart应用程序后,要创建流程,请选择Processes选项卡,然后单击Create Process: 流程编辑器将打开,我们可以拖放开始事件,各种类型任务和结束事件各种符号来定义流程...3.3 任务应用程序 在任务应用程序中,有两个选项卡:任务 – 用于当前正在运行任务,以及流程 – 用于当前正在运行流程。 单击“ 流程中开始流程”选项卡后,我们将获得可以运行可用流程列表。...在我们示例中,用户任务仍处于待处理状态,会突出显示: 要完成此任务,我们可以单击Complete butto n。如前所述,我们需要输入消息,因为我们必须保留它。...“name”: null, “completed”: false } 我们可以使用上一个响应返回流程实例id来查看正在运行流程图: GET http://127.0.0.1:8080/activiti-rest...完成任务 现在让我们看看我们处理任务: GET http://127.0.0.1:8080/activiti-rest/service/runtime/tasks 响应将包含待处理任务列表。

1.5K40

JQuery事件处理

”> //JQuery中目前有两个合成事件hover(),toggle();你可以这样理解:合成事件就是可以触发两个函数事件 //鼠标停留显示隐藏内容,离开触发第二个函数隐藏内容 /*$(function...博客 //比如一个父元素绑定了一个事件,而父元素内部后代元素又绑定了一个事件这样后代元素事件响应时候父元素事件响应响应呢?...(){ alert(“子元素事件被激活”); }); });*/ //单击b包含内容会激活两个事件这样怎么才能解决?...();//不带参数会移除所有事件,带事件类型参数会移除指定事件,带有事件类型以及处理函数作为参数那么移除指定事件处理函数 }); 5、  模拟事件示例代码: //很多事件都是有用户单击或者鼠标划过来触发,可是刚打开页面我们有没有办法直接触发呢?

2.8K50

关于React18更新几个新功能,你需要了解下

默认情况下,React 中不会对 promise、setTimeout、本机事件处理程序或任何其他事件更新进行批处理。 什么是自动批处理?...这意味着超时、承诺、本机事件处理程序或任何其他事件更新将以与 React 事件更新相同方式进行批处理。...这会使您应用程序在初始加载时变慢且响应。 React 18 正试图解决这个问题。... 组件已经以这样方式进行了革命性改变,它将应用程序分解为更小独立单元,这些单元经过提到每个步骤。这样一旦用户看到内容,它就会变成互动。...对于大屏幕更新,这可能会导致页面在呈现所有内容时出现延迟,从而使打字或其他交互感觉缓慢且响应

5.4K30

关于React18更新几个新功能,你需要了解下

默认情况下,React 中不会对 promise、setTimeout、本机事件处理程序或任何其他事件更新进行批处理。 什么是自动批处理?...这意味着超时、承诺、本机事件处理程序或任何其他事件更新将以与 React 事件更新相同方式进行批处理。...这会使您应用程序在初始加载时变慢且响应。 React 18 正试图解决这个问题。... 组件已经以这样方式进行了革命性改变,它将应用程序分解为更小独立单元,这些单元经过提到每个步骤。这样一旦用户看到内容,它就会变成互动。...对于大屏幕更新,这可能会导致页面在呈现所有内容时出现延迟,从而使打字或其他交互感觉缓慢且响应

5.9K50

11 Confluent_Kafka权威指南 第十一章:流计算

Request-response 请求响应 这是最低延迟范例,响应时间重从亚毫秒到几毫秒不等。通常期望响应时间高度一致。处理模式通常是阻塞,应用程序发送一个请求,然后等待处理系统响应。...这允许你保留自己私有副本,并且当发生数据更改事件时,你将得到通知,以便相应更改自己副本。 ? 然后,当你获得单击事件时,你可以在本地缓存中查找user_id,并丰富该事件。...这在kafka流中工作方式就是,两个流,查询和点击,在相同key上分区,也是连接key。这样,来自user_id:42所有单击事件将在单击topic分区5中结束。...Building a Topology 建立一个拓扑 每个streams应用程序实现和执行至少一个拓扑。拓扑结构在其他流处理框架中也称为DAG,或者有向环图。...这样的话听起来就不像要给很好服务了,但是已经有了数次这样经历。

1.5K20

【融职培训】Web前端学习 第10章 小程序开发4 小程序开发

一,数据绑定 VUE:vue动态绑定一个变量变量元素某个属性时候,会在变量前面加上冒号:,例: title属性绑定了数据 小程序:绑定变量变量元素属性时...,会用两个大括号括起来,如果不加括号,为被认为是字符串。...小程序中,使用wx-if和hidden控制元素显示和隐藏 四,事件处理 vue:习惯@event绑定事件,例如: 添加1 小程序:用bindtap绑定事件,例如: 明天不上班 五,绑定事件传参 在vue中,绑定事件传参挺简单,只需要在触发事件方法中...日志(arg ) 8 } 9 } 10 } ) 在小程序中,不能直接在绑定事件方法中进行参数调整,需要将参数作为属性值,绑定到元素上数据属性上,然后在方法中,通过e.currentTarget.dataset

1.3K42

VC2008中如何为MFC应用程序添加和删除消息响应函数

最近重温《MFC Windows应用程序设计》第二版这本书,里面的代码全部是使用VC6.0写Win7下安装是VS2008开发环境。        ...一、VC2008中自动添加消息响应函数       举一个《MFC Windows应用程序设计》MFC单文档应用程序例子,如下:        例4-9  设计一个利用CClientDC绘图,在窗口单击鼠标左键之后...新浪博主百里二转载一篇博文很简洁:             VC2008 中添加MFC消息处理函数具体步骤如下: · 1.在类视图中,右键需要添加处理函数类,选择属性。...· 2.在“属性”窗口中,单击“消息”按钮。 · 3.在消息列表框中,选择需要添加消息。 · 4.这样就可以在代码框中看到,OnCreate已经添加了。...2、源文件中消息响应,如:ON_COMMAND(ID_DIALOG_MODEL, &CMyboleView::OnDialogModel)             3、源文件中具体函数体,例如void

1.8K20
领券